1. Read the following passage carefully and answer the questions that follow:
1. Maharana Pratap ruled over Mewar
only for 25 years. However, he accomplished so much grandeur during his reign
that his glory surpassed the boundaries of countries and time turning him into
an immortal personality. He, along with his kingdom, become a synonym for
valour, sacrifice and patriotism. Mewar had been a leading Rajput kingdom even
before Maharana Pratap occupied the throne. Kings of Mewar, with the
cooperation of their nobles and subjects, had established such traditions in
the kingdom, as augmented their magnificence, despite the hurdles of having a
smaller area under their command and less population. There did come a few
thorny occasions when the flag of the kingdom seemed sliding down. Their flag
once again heaved high in the sky, thanks to the gallantry and brilliance of
the people of Mewar.
2. The destiny of Mewar was good in
the sense that barring a few kings, most of the rulers were competent and
patriotic. This glorious tradition of the kingdom almost continued for 1500
years since its establishment, right from the reign of Bappa Rawal. In fact,
only 60 years before Maharana Pratap, Rana Sanga drove the kingdom to the
pinnacle of fame. His reputation went beyond Rajasthan and reached Delhi. Two
generations before him, Rana Kumbha had given a new stature to the kingdom
through victories and developmental work. During his reign, literature and art
also progressed extraordinarily. Rana himself was inclined towards writing and
his works are read with reverence, even today. The ambience of his kingdom was
conducive to the creation of high-quality work of art and literature. These
accomplishments were the outcome of a long-standing tradition sustained by
several generations.
3. The life of the people of Mewar
must have been peaceful and prosperous during the long span of time; otherwise,
such extraordinary accomplishment in these fields would not have been possible.
This is reflected in their art and literature as well as their loving nature.
They compensate for lack of admirable physique by their firm but pleasant
nature. The ambience of Mewar remains lovely, thanks to the cheerful and
liberal character of its people.
4. One may observe astonishing
pieces of workmanship not only in the forts and palaces of Mewar but also in
public utility buildings. Ruins of many structures which are still standing
tall in their grandeur are testimony to the fact that Mewar was not only the
land of the brave but also a seat of art and culture. Amidst aggression and
bloodshed, literature and art flourished and creative pursuits of literature
and artists did not suffer. Imagine, how glorious the period must have been
when the Vijaya Stambha which is the sample of our great ancient architecture
even today, was constructed. In the same fort, Kirti Stambha is standing high,
reflecting how liberal the then administration was which allowed people from
other communities and kingdoms to come and carry out construction work. It is
useless to indulge in the debate whether the Vijaya Stambha was constructed
first or the Kirti Stambha. The fact is that both the capitals are standing
side by side and reveal the proximity between the king and the subjects of
Mewar.
5. The cycle of time does not remain
the same. Whereas the reign of Rana Sanga was crucial in raising the kingdom to
the acme of glory, it also proved to be his nemesis. History took a turn. The
fortune of Mewar - the land of the brave started waning. Rana tried to save the
day with his acumen which was running against the stream and the glorious
traditions for some time.

Report on Disaster Management Talk
In response to the frequent earthquakes, floods, and
torrential rains in various parts of the country, a talk on disaster management
was organised in our school auditorium. The aim of this session was to raise
awareness about effective disaster response. The speaker, who is a member of
the National Disaster Response Force, emphasised the importance of preparedness
and talked about key precautionary measures for both the public and the
government. He highlighted the need for emergency kits, regular drills, and
clear evacuation plans. Visual aids were used to demonstrate safety measures
during emergency situations, such as keeping calm, moving to safe areas, and
following official instructions. The talk proved to be highly informative,
equipping the students with valuable knowledge to minimize risks and respond
efficiently during disasters.
